Watercolour Essentials: A Journey from Basics to Beyond
Week 1: Introduction to Watercolor Basics
• Session Overview: Dive into the world of watercolors with this initial foundational session. Learn about essential materials, techniques like washes and gradients, and colour mixing basics.
• What you will learn: Brush types and strokes, wet on wet vs wet on dry techniques, understanding pigment behaviour and creating simple compositions
Week 2: Exploring Techniques and Styles
• Session Overview: Build on your foundational skills and explore different watercolour techniques. Focus on texture creation, layering, and experimenting with styles such as botanicals, landscapes, or abstracts.
• What you will learn: Techniques for lifting colour, glazing, dry brushing, masking fluid applications and style explorations through guided exercises.
Week 3: Advanced Applications and Composition & Bringing it all together – Personal Style Development & Growth
• Session Overview: Elevate your watercolour practice with advanced techniques and compositional principles. Learn how to plan and execute more complex paintings, emphasizing balance, focal points, and visual storytelling.
Reflect on your journey and refine your personal style under practiced guidance. Receive feedback on your journey with practical tips and suggestions for overcoming common issues, explore different artistic paths, and plan your future projects.
• What you will learn: Colour theory in depth, advanced wash techniques, composition fundamentals, creating depth and atmosphere.
Developing a personal artistic voice, self-critique skills, how to work in a series, choosing and using your own reference photos & what is painting En Plein Air
